Full text of the license can be */ /* found in the LICENSE file at https://aka.ms/AzureRTOS_EULA */ /* and in the root directory of this software. */ /* */... /**************************************************************************/ ... /**************************************************************************/ /**************************************************************************/ /** */ /** USBX Component */ /** */ /** Host Stack */ /** */... /**************************************************************************/ /**************************************************************************/ /* Include necessary system files. */ #define UX_SOURCE_CODE #include "ux_api.h" #include "ux_host_stack.h" ... /**************************************************************************/ /* */ /* FUNCTION RELEASE */ /* */ /* _ux_host_stack_class_instance_verify PORTABLE C */ /* 6.1 */ /* AUTHOR */ /* */ /* Chaoqiong Xiao, Microsoft Corporation */ /* */ /* DESCRIPTION */ /* */ /* This function ensures that a given instance exists. An application */ /* is not responsible for keeping the instance valid pointer. The */ /* class is responsible for the instance checks if the instance is */ /* still valid. */ /* */ /* INPUT */ /* */ /* class_name Name of class */ /* class_instance Pointer to class instance */ /* */ /* OUTPUT */ /* */ /* Completion Status */ /* */ /* CALLS */ /* */ /* _ux_utility_string_length_check Check C string and return its */ /* length if null-terminated */ /* _ux_utility_memory_compare Compare blocks of memory */ /* */ /* CALLED BY */ /* */ /* USBX Components */ /* */ /* RELEASE HISTORY */ /* */ /* DATE NAME DESCRIPTION */ /* */ /* 05-19-2020 Chaoqiong Xiao Initial Version 6.0 */ /* 09-30-2020 Chaoqiong Xiao Modified comment(s), */ /* optimized based on compile */ /* definitions, */ /* resulting in version 6.1 */ /* */... /**************************************************************************/ UINT _ux_host_stack_class_instance_verify(UCHAR *class_name, VOID *class_instance) { UX_HOST_CLASS *class_inst; #if UX_MAX_CLASS_DRIVER > 1 ULONG class_index; #endif VOID **current_class_instance; #if !defined(UX_NAME_REFERENCED_BY_POINTER) UINT status; UINT class_name_length = 0;/* ... */ #endif #if !defined(UX_NAME_REFERENCED_BY_POINTER) /* Get the length of the class name (exclude null-terminator). */ status = _ux_utility_string_length_check(class_name, &class_name_length, UX_MAX_CLASS_NAME_LENGTH); if (status) return(status);/* ... */ #endif /* Get first class. */ class_inst = _ux_system_host -> ux_system_host_class_array; #if UX_MAX_CLASS_DRIVER > 1 /* We need to parse the class table. */ for(class_index = 0; class_index < _ux_system_host -> ux_system_host_max_class; class_index++) { #endif /* Check if this class is already used. */ if (class_inst -> ux_host_class_status == UX_USED) { /* Start with the first class instance attached to the class container. */ current_class_instance = class_inst -> ux_host_class_first_instance; /* Traverse the list of the class instances until we find the correct instance. */ while (current_class_instance != UX_NULL) { /* Check the class instance attached to the container with the caller's instance. *//* ... */ if (current_class_instance == class_instance) { /* We have found the class container. Check if this is the one we need (compare including null-terminator). */ if (ux_utility_name_match(class_inst-> ux_host_class_name, class_name, class_name_length + 1)) return(UX_SUCCESS); }if (current_class_instance == class_instance) { ... } /* Points to the next class instance. */ current_class_instance = *current_class_instance; }while (current_class_instance != UX_NULL) { ... } }if (class_inst -> ux_host_class_status == UX_USED) { ... } #if UX_MAX_CLASS_DRIVER > 1 /* Move to the next class. */ class_inst ++; }for (class_index = 0; class_index < _ux_system_host -> ux_system_host_max_class; class_index++) { ... } #endif /* If trace is enabled, insert this event into the trace buffer. */ UX_TRACE_IN_LINE_INSERT(UX_TRACE_ERROR, UX_HOST_CLASS_INSTANCE_UNKNOWN, class_instance, 0, 0, UX_TRACE_ERRORS, 0, 0) /* This class does not exist. */ return(UX_HOST_CLASS_INSTANCE_UNKNOWN); }{ ... }
